Description

“The Our World series continues to pack quite a bit of culture for the youngest readers into an easy-to-handle board book” – Booklist

Habari! Let's explore Kenya! Savor fluffy mandazis, count the colorful mabati roofs, and play a game of kati kati. Even learn words in Swahili with pronunciation guides throughout the story.
  • Part of the Barefoot Books Our World series
  • Written by Kenyan author Maïmouna Jallow and illustrated by Lulu Kitololo
  • Endmatter provides more insights into life in Kenya

Author's Bio

Maïmouna Jallow is a multidisciplinary artist and writer. She is the author of several children’s books, including I’m the Colour of Honey and Story Story, Story Come, an anthology of re-imagined African folktales. Her debut film, Tales of the Accidental City, is an experimental feature-length in which all the action takes place on Zoom. A lover of theatre, Maïmouna has also adapted novels for the stage. She is currently based in Barcelona, Spain.

Lulu Kitololo is a Kenyan-born illustrator and designer. Her work celebrates diversity – drawing inspiration from nature, as well as cultures and crafts from around the world and her beloved home continent, Africa. Lulu's signature aesthetic involves soulful, hand-drawn illustrations, quirky hand-lettering, and vibrant patterns.
